#550998 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#550998 is composed of 33.3% red, 3.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44.1% cyan, 94.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 271.9 degrees, a saturation of 88.8% and a lightness of 31.6%. #550998 color hex could be obtained by blending #aa12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#550998 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#550998 has RGB values of R:85, G:9,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.44, M:0.94,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 5573016.

Hex triplet 550998 #550998
RGB Decimal 85, 9, 152 rgb(85,9,152)
RGB Percent 33.3, 3.5, 59.6 rgb(33.3%,3.5%,59.6%)
CMYK 44, 94, 0, 40
HSL 271.9°, 88.8, 31.6 hsl(271.9,88.8%,31.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 271.9°, 94.1, 59.6
Web Safe 660099 #660099
CIE-LAB 24.933, 55.694, -59.642
XYZ 9.511, 4.394, 30.051
xyY 0.216, 0.1, 4.394
CIE-LCH 24.933, 81.603, 313.039
CIE-LUV 24.933, 10.348, -74.387
Hunter-Lab 20.961, 44.308, -70.328
Binary 01010101, 00001001, 10011000

Shades and Tints of #550998

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020004 is the darkest color, while #f8f0fe is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#550998 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#303030 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#372845 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#004382 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#004772 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#454449 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#1e2e8a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#1e3080 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#4b2f66 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
